Abstract

The utility model relates to a vertical axle roll pressing crusher which is used for crushing cement clinker. A movable toothed plate on a rotor is driven by a power transmission mechanism of the utility model. A V-shaped crushing chamber is formed between the movable toothed plate and a fixed toothed plate, and rack gears of the movable and the fixed toothed plates are vertical. The upper end of a V-shaped circle of a taper is butted with a backing block which extends from a lower cone of a machine body, and a circle of flange is fixed on the lower end of the V-shaped circle of the taper. An adjusting screw rod on the flange is butted on a saddle block which extends from the lower cone of the machine body. The utility model has the advantages of uniform abrasion of the toothed plates and long service life, and production efficiency is improved, cement clinker with different granularity can be milled out according to requirements and the bearing is convenient to replace when the bearing is broken.

Description

Vertical shaft roll-in disintegrating machine
Affiliated technical field
The utility model is a kind of clinker crushing mechanism, particularly carries out the vertical shaft roll-in disintegrating machine of grog fragmentation by extruding.
Background technology
At present, the clinker fragmentation mainly is to use horizontal axis hammer mill and vertical-spindle hammer crusher, and this machinery is to rely on the tup adorned on the rotor to bump with grog in high speed rotating to carry out fragmentation.Its shortcoming is that parts wear and tear easily, and the tup wearing and tearing are big, because tup is fixed on the rotor, rotor rotation forms off-centre, and main shaft bearing damages easily, and power consumption is big, and airborne dust is many, work under bad environment.For overcoming above-mentioned shortcoming, Chinese patent discloses a kind of scissor-type crusher.This patent is cut coarse grained grog carefully by force by the projection of lateral arrangement on fixed, moving two shear blades, thereby reaches the purpose of grog refinement.Though this patent has solved the shortcoming of above-mentioned horizontal axis hammer and vertical-spindle hammer crusher, also has following shortcoming: 1, fixed, moving two shear blades are coarse granule to be cut carefully by force, and corresponding shear blade wearing and tearing are big, need to change at any time; 2, the broken crusher chamber size of the V-type between two shear blades is fixed, can't be according to the size of producing needs change crusher chamber, to produce the different grain size clinker; 3, change during damage of bearings inconvenient.
Summary of the invention
The purpose of this utility model is to overcome above-mentioned the deficiencies in the prior art, providing a kind of pushes the clinker coarse granule levigate step by step, thereby reduce the wearing and tearing of grinding tool, the vertical shaft roll-in disintegrating machine of enhancing productivity, the utility model can be according to producing needs simultaneously, change the size of crusher chamber, to grind varigrained clinker.
Solution of the present utility model is: a kind of vertical shaft roll-in disintegrating machine, the rotor following peripheral that its power transmission mechanism drives is provided with moving tooth plate, on the circular cone V-type circle by the supporting of body slower conical tube quiet tooth plate is set, form the V-type crusher chamber between moving tooth plate and the quiet tooth plate, be connected on the organism top case on the body slower conical tube and have charging aperture, the tooth bar that is characterized in moving tooth plate and quiet tooth plate is for vertical, circular cone V-type circle upper end lean against that the body slower conical tube stretches out by on the piece, a circle flange is fixed in circular cone V-type circle lower end, have on the flange on the adjusting screw(rod), adjusting screw(rod) withstands on the saddle that the body slower conical tube stretches out.
Its course of work is: clinker enters from charging aperture, falls into after the crusher chamber in the rotation of rotor, by dynamic and static tooth plate it is carried out fragmentation.Owing to form the V-type crusher chamber between the dynamic and static tooth plate, the tooth bar of dynamic and static tooth plate is vertical, after so thick particle falls between the dynamic and static tooth plate, in the rotation of rotor, little by mill gradually, whereabouts, it is little to regrind, and falls again, falls collection from dynamic and static tooth plate lower port after wearing into desired particle size.Simultaneously,, adjust adjusting screw(rod), make the quiet tooth plate that is fixed on the circular cone V-type circle vertically, move down, thereby regulate the gap between quiet tooth plate and the moving tooth plate, reached and produce varigrained clinker according to producing needs.
For ease of changing rotor bearing, make the rotational support top chock of rotor and the step center, upper surface by being bolted to organism top case and the center, lower surface of body slower conical tube respectively in the solution of the present utility model.After rolling bearing damages like this, take off bolt, conveniently replaced behind the taking-up bearing block.
For making the rotor rotation balance, axis is set between the bearing block in the solution of the present utility model.Upper and lower like this bearing block is connected as a single entity, and can drive rotor rotation more reposefully, helps improving squeezing grinding efficient.In addition, the rotor upper shaft is propped up by a screw rod, in case upper and lower the beating of spline.
The utility model advantage compared with prior art: owing to form the V-type crusher chamber between the dynamic and static tooth plate of the utility model, the tooth bar of dynamic and static tooth plate is vertical, so after thick particle falls into crusher chamber, little by mill gradually, whereabouts, it is little to regrind, fall, up to wearing into desired particle size, its process is that the working face of dynamic and static tooth plate is all used again, therefore, the tooth plate wearing and tearing are more even, long service life, thus enhance productivity.Simultaneously, quiet tooth plate can move up and down circular cone V-type circle by adjusting screw(rod), thereby regulates the gap between the dynamic and static tooth plate, and to grind varigrained clinker, the scope of application is extensive.
